Solved | Opening external links in new window or tab

#1 Post by dmw71 »

I'm thinking it would be nice if links to external websites opened in a new tab (preferably) or new window instead of actually having a person leave the Unseen Server forums when clicking on it. In no way is this a big deal, but might be a nice-to-have type of feature.

For instance, say I wanted to link to a table on the Purple Worm website in a rules thread: Strength

If you click on the above link, you're actually moved to the Purple Worm website and leave Unseen Servant. You can always hit the 'back' button to return, but I'm a tab-user and almost never rely on the 'back' button (but am occasionally really glad it's there!). Of course, there's always the option of right-clicking on the link and selecting the preferred option, but that only works if you know the link is external in the first place.
